The FS-N11MN is equipped with the analog voltage output function.
In the initial setting, voltage is output within the range of 1-5 V to the displayed
received light intensity of 0 to 4000.
The received light intensity corresponding to analog voltage of 5V can be changed
within the range stated below:
Setting range of received light intensity corresponding to 5V:
50
to
65535
* (Initial value:
4000
)
Setting range of received light intensity corresponding to 1V:
0
fixed (cannot be changed)

* The FS-N11MN shipped before March 10, 2011 becomes 100 - 9999.
Received light intensity corrected with the preset function and
DATUM1/2 mode is not reflected in the analog output.
• When the work preset function, maximum sensitivity preset func-
tion or full automatic preset function is used, correction is made
so that the light intensity that becomes ".0" will correspond to the
analog voltage of 1V.
While various preset functions are enabled, pressing the [PRESET]
button on the Analog Scaling Setting screen automatically sets
analog output scaling values so that 5V will be output to the cur-
rent value of "100.0".
When the analog scaling mode setting is changed, the analog out-
put scaling values will be automatically set each time preset is per-
formed. (Correction by presetting is reflected in the analog output.)
"Analog output scaling (FS-N11MN only)" (page 4-21)
Correction of the received light intensity using the zero shift
function is reflected in the analog output.
